Adding a Nonworker to an Organization

A nonworker is an individual, such as a volunteer or security guard, who is not part of the core business but may still receive payments from the organization. To be classified as a nonworker, the person must have a nonworker work relationship with a legal employer, which defines their association but does not imply actual employment.
